An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) is valid for 10 years. If you make major energy-saving improvements, like adding solar panels or new insulation, it’s a good idea to get a new assessment to show your property’s improved efficiency and lower energy costs.
Yes. It is a legal requirement to have a valid EPC before selling or renting any residential or commercial property. Failure to provide an EPC to prospective buyers or tenants can result in fines from local authorities.

A low EPC rating (F or G) can stop you from legally renting your property under MEES rules. Your certificate includes a “Recommendations” section with practical, cost-effective improvements like LED lighting or loft insulation to help increase your rating and reduce energy costs.
